This document is the draft annual report for the Bergrivier Local Municipality for the financial year 2021/22, which includes audit reports, financial statements, and performance reports.

Understanding the Volume Draft Annual Form: A Comprehensive Guide

Overview of the Volume Draft Annual Form

The Volume II Draft Annual Form serves as a critical document for organizations to report essential financial and operational data. This form is designed to compile various metrics,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ements while providing a structured way for organizations to present their annual performance.

Accurate completion of the Volume II Draft Annual Form is vital for maintaining transparency and accountability within an organization. Mistakes or omissions can lead to compliance issues that may have significant financial and legal implications. This form is predominantly used by corporate entities, non-profits, and government agencies to provide stakeholders with a comprehensive snapshot of their operations over the year.

Key features of the Volume Draft Annual Form

The Volume II Draft Annual Form is structured into several key sections, each designed to gather specific information pertinent to regulatory and reporting requirements. This breakdown includes sections such as financial summaries, operational metrics, and compliance checks, each tailored to capture vital aspects of an organization’s performance.

For instance, the financial summary section demands precise data on total income, expenditures, and profit margins, while the operational metrics require details about workforce numbers and service delivery effectiveness. Many users often misunderstand the importance of consistency in the figures provided, leading to discrepancies that can skew the overall report.

Financial Summary – requires income, expenses, and profit figures.
Operational Metrics – captures performance data on service delivery and workforce.
Compliance Section – checks for adherence to relevant laws and regulations.

Understanding compliance with the Volume Draft Annual Form

Compliance with laws and regulations is a fundamental aspect of the Volume II Draft Annual Form. Organizations must be keenly aware of deadlines for submissions, as late filings can result in significant consequences, including fines and reputational damage.

Moreover, incomplete or inaccurate filings can trigger audits and further scrutiny, complicating operational processes. Thus, being meticulous in data collection and reporting is paramount to maintaining organizational integrity and compliance.
